hi there  JJ and welcome. I think you are the 1st person I know of interested in these silly things in NM.  Tho there are  fair few in Texas now.The best guy on here you need to speak to is XS ( pm him). He is up in Rhode Island. But basically knows everything States side. He's coordinated meets in Washington DC and NYC with Boston Mass comming up ( I believe something is being organised NC way nearer Christmas but Im not certain and I fear it will not help you too much).

He also knows which products are availble in the USA and which are not . You may find you do research only to find that due to patent laws they cant be sold your way. Equally there is one model of poweriZer sod in the states that is not available in the UK. 

So basically chat to XS ( welll nicks his name)
